Overview of Supplier Qualification Management Software Market
Supplier Qualification Management Software (SQMS) encompasses digital platforms designed to streamline and automate the process of evaluating, onboarding, and continuously monitoring suppliers. These solutions facilitate efficient collection, validation, and management of supplier data, including compliance documentation, risk assessments, and performance metrics. Core products include cloud-based applications, integrated enterprise systems, and specialized modules tailored for specific industry needs.
Key end-use industries for SQMS include manufacturing, healthcare, retail, aerospace, and government procurement. These sectors rely heavily on supplier qualification to ensure quality, compliance, and risk mitigation, making SQMS vital for maintaining supply chain integrity. In the global economy, effective supplier qualification directly impacts operational efficiency, regulatory adherence, and competitive advantage, underscoring the importance of advanced software solutions in today’s interconnected supply networks.

Supplier Qualification Management Software Market Drivers
Growing demand for supply chain transparency and compliance is a primary driver, as organizations seek to mitigate risks associated with supplier misconduct, quality issues, and regulatory breaches. Industry expansion, especially in manufacturing and healthcare, amplifies the need for rigorous supplier vetting processes. Digital transformation initiatives across sectors accelerate adoption of automated qualification tools, reducing manual effort and enhancing accuracy.
Government policies emphasizing supplier diversity, sustainability, and compliance further stimulate market growth. For example, regulations mandating environmental and social governance (ESG) reporting compel companies to adopt advanced qualification solutions. The increasing complexity of global supply chains and the need for real-time data-driven decision-making are also significant factors propelling the market forward.
Supplier Qualification Management Software Market Restraints
High implementation costs and ongoing maintenance expenses pose significant barriers, especially for small and medium-sized enterprises. Regulatory hurdles vary across regions, complicating compliance efforts and increasing the complexity of qualification processes. Supply chain disruptions, such as geopolitical tensions and pandemics, can hinder software deployment and adoption, creating temporary setbacks.
Market saturation in mature regions may limit growth potential, as many organizations already utilize existing solutions, leading to slower adoption rates. Additionally, concerns over data security and privacy, especially with cloud-based platforms, can restrain organizations from fully embracing these technologies. These factors collectively challenge the rapid expansion of the market but also highlight areas for strategic innovation.

Supplier Qualification Management Software Market Segmentation Analysis
By Type, the market segments into cloud-based platforms, on-premises solutions, and hybrid models. Cloud-based solutions are expected to dominate due to scalability, ease of deployment, and lower upfront costs, with an anticipated CAGR of around 12% over the next decade. On-premises solutions may see slower growth, primarily in highly regulated sectors requiring data sovereignty.
By Application, manufacturing and healthcare sectors are the largest adopters, driven by stringent compliance requirements. The fastest-growing application segment is in the aerospace and defense industry, where supplier qualification is critical for safety and regulatory adherence. Regionally, North America and Europe will continue to lead, but APAC is projected to witness the highest growth rate, fueled by expanding industrial activity and digital initiatives.
